Trading costs are a major consideration for Kazakhstan traders, especially those dealing in large volumes. VT Markets offers some of the tightest spreads in the industry, starting from 0.0 pips on its ECN account (with a commission). AvaTrade’s spreads are competitive but generally wider, averaging 0.9 pips on major pairs like EUR/USD. However, AvaTrade’s standard accounts are commission-free, which can benefit lower-volume traders. For high-frequency or high-volume traders in Kazakhstan, VT Markets may lead to lower overall costs. Always factor in the spread and any commissions based on your typical trade size.

Both brokers provide the popular M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MT5 platforms, which are widely used by Kazakhstan traders for their advanced charting and automated trading capabilities. AvaTrade additionally offers its proprietary web platform and mobile apps, along with integration with automated trading tools like ZuluTrade and DupliTrade. VT Markets focuses on MT4/MT5 and also gives access to a dedicated mobile app. For traders in Kazakhstan who need reliable mobile access and fast execution, both platforms perform well, though AvaTrade’s extra features may appeal to those seeking a more comprehensive trading ecosystem.

Execution quality directly impacts your trading results. VT Markets uses an ECN/STP model with No Dealing Desk (NDD) execution, offering speeds as low as 20 milliseconds and deep liquidity. AvaTrade operates a hybrid model with both Dealing Desk and NDD execution depending on the account type. For Kazakhstan traders who rely on scalping or fast news trading, VT Markets typically provides faster execution and fewer requotes. AvaTrade’s execution is reliable, but may have less consistency during volatile periods.

While neither AvaTrade nor VT Markets is directly regulated by a local financial regulator in Kazakhstan, they operate under licenses from multiple top-tier authorities. AvaTrade is regulated by the Central Bank of Ireland, ASIC in Australia, and the FSCA in South Africa, among others. VT Markets holds licenses from the FSCA and ASIC as well, plus regulation in Cyprus (CySEC). For Kazakhstan traders, this means your funds are held in segregated accounts and protected under strict international rules. While no local regulator oversight exists, choosing a broker with strong multi-jurisdictional regulation provides a solid safety net.

For Muslim traders in Kazakhstan seeking Sharia-compliant trading, both AvaTrade and VT Markets off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ts. These accounts eliminate overnight swap fees, ensuring no interest is earned or paid. AvaTrade provides Islamic accounts on request, with no extra charges, while VT Markets also offers swap-free status across most account types. However, some instruments may have a limited holding period or a swap-free administration fee after a certain number of days. Kazakhstan traders should review the terms carefully to ensure full compliance with Islamic finance principles.
